Big Island Visitor's Bureau gets New Director of Sales

Waynette KwonGeorge Applegate, executive director for the Big Island Visitors Bureau, announced the organization has appointed Waynette Kwon as BIVB's new director of sales, effective immediately. 

Kwon, who most recently served as Director of the Lanai Visitors Bureau since 2002, will be based in BIVB's Waimea office and will travel frequently, promoting the appeal of Hawaii Island as a destination to travel agents, wholesalers and consumers. She will direct the leisure sales activities for the U.S. mainland and Canada, and assist BIVB's senior director of sales Debbie Hogan with conventions, meetings and incentive opportunities, as well as nurture markets in Europe, Asia and Oceania.

Kwon, who was born and raised in Kona, is a graduate of Konawaena High School and Kapi'olani Community College.
 
Her background in tourism and hospitality includes finance, advertising, sales, marketing, plus community and public relations. Prior to becoming Director at Lanai Visitors Bureau, she worked for Castle & Cooke Resorts, LLC on Lanai, and was the Aloha Week Hawaii manager for Lanai.
 
Kwon is moving back to Hawaii Island with her husband and two children. A third child attends college on the U.S. mainland.
